Sunstar. Let me give some people some insight on the situation.

In MMV, Terra may be the leaser of the stardroids, but that doesn't make him the final boss, even though he can be a bit though with him using Spark Chaser and freezing you with those three orbs. However, PLOT TWIST, Wily was behind the whole thing.

You then go through a stage that has rematches with the killers and Quint, then astardroid rematch. You then fight Wily's Brain Crusher robot, but even after you beat Wily, it's STILL not over, as he reveals the ancient superweapon itself, Sunstar, who proceeds to upstage wily himself. The fight is also pretty cool, with there being 3 stages and everything doing a mere 1 damage to him, even a charged Mega Arm shot. At the end of the fight, he has 1 hp, and Mega Man offers to get him fixed, but Sunstar's fusion Reator goes critical, and Sunstar demands that Mega Man leave the Wily Star so Mega Man doesn't get blown up.

Pretty cool stuff right there, even if you don't get a weapon from him.
